The Business Support Manager will form an integral part of the PCMHSS Leadership structure supporting quality, patient safety and experience, service development and service improvement.
The successful candidate will join a friendly and compassionate department who are motivated to provide the best possible care to adults seeking assessment psychological care and support. The Business Support Manager will help us achieve this aim through Administration Line Management, and by supporting core processes, attending to information governance and data quality as well as monitoring patient experience.
Main duties of the job
The role will include:
1. Providing advice and guidance to ensure effective planning, service development and project management.
2. Monitoring of quality indicators.
3. Supporting and embedding audit.
4. Collection, analysis and presentation of performance data.

The health board provides integrated acute, primary and community care serving a population of 650,000 and employing over 16,000 staff.

Our Clinical Futures strategy continues to enhance and promote care closer to home as well as high quality hospital care when needed. This includes the Grange University Hospital which provides specialist and critical care and is the newest addition to the clinical futures strategy opening in November 2020.
